How to fill out the Affidavit Declaration online

This guide provides clear and concise instructions on how to complete the Affidavit Declaration online. This document is essential for parents applying for a passport for their minor child or children in India, ensuring the process is straightforward and compliant with requirements.

Follow the steps to successfully complete your Affidavit Declaration.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the Affidavit Declaration form and open it in the editor.
  2. In the first section, fill in your full name as the holder of the passport. Provide your passport number, the location where it was issued, and the date of issue. Next, include your residential address in Saudi Arabia.
  3. In the next part, indicate your relationship to the child or children for whom you are applying for a passport. Provide the full name of the spouse or partner and their parentage, specifying if they are the son or daughter of the referenced individual.
  4. For each child, fill in their name, date of birth, sex, and relationship to you. Be thorough and ensure the details are accurate.
  5. Affirm that no other passport exists in the name of the listed child or children by checking the appropriate box or indicating 'none' as necessary.
  6. State that the listed child or children require passports to visit Saudi Arabia, and confirm your consent for obtaining these passports.
  7. Ensure to submit a photocopy of your passport alongside the application, as this is a requirement.
  8. Once you have completed all sections, carefully review the entire document to check for any errors or missing information.
  9. After you are satisfied with the accuracy of the completed form, you can save your changes. Options will typically include downloading, printing, or sharing the Affidavit Declaration form for submission.

Affidavit means a written statement confirmed by oath or affirmation, typically for use as evidence in court. It serves as a powerful tool in the legal system, as it allows individuals to present their testimonies formally. An affidavit of declaration is a specific type of affidavit that provides a formal statement of facts or opinions, signed under oath. This type of affidavit is commonly used to confirm the truth of certain assertions in various legal situations. In many cases, an affidavit of declaration can support a legal case or idea presented in a court.
